Show filters
Sort by

Don’t leave so soon. You can test our service for

Start now
4.31/5
1756 reviews from 4 sources
103 Garner Dr, Del Rio
3.86/5
762 reviews from 4 sources
2114 Veterans Blvd, Del Rio
3.74/5
523 reviews from 4 sources
2050 N Bedell Ave, Del Rio
MAP LIST